找到约 497 条结果
  • 作为一个半路转学ios开发的开发者,从我两个月的开发经历来看,objective-c一点也不难。我的开发的程序经历了如下的变迁,我也趁机来总结下得失
    2012-03-23
  • 证明你还没有搞清楚C语言中的pointer这个概念。 在Objective-C当中,你没有搞清楚ARC这个内存管理的概念。 首先,你要搞清楚值传递和引用传递的概念。 然后再去理解,就会一目了然。 这里很明显你存储的数据是一样的,只是用了不同的Key。 如果你还是不明白,你应该问问自己:为什么值会不同,你明明就是存储一样的东西。
    2014-12-11
  • 简单来讲,Neo4j Browser用到了D3的一些框架。但经过了不少自定义开发。而且,整套Neo4j Browser是开源的,我们可以找到源代码里面的可视化这部分详细了解:[链接]另外,要对图数据进行可视化,也有很多不同的工具和库来实现,比如Neo4j Bloom。官方文档也列出了不少工具:[链接]
    2022-05-13
  • {代码...}
    2020-08-11
  • 确保你在调用之前构造随机数生成器(例如 srandom(time(NULL))),否则输出的就不是随机数。 Abramodj 解决办法在这:
    2014-01-23
  • canvas就行分成四部分:1.底层圆环;2.上层圆环;3.小圆;4.文字部分;画圆环比较容易,百度上多的是,小白圆也好画,主要是位置需要计算,根据进度,线宽,小圆自身尺寸,确定坐标,需要精确计算,多试试,也不难。我这儿正好有个一模一样的东西。你拿去参考。代码时vue组件,内容多一些,思路就是上面这个思路。
    2020-06-05
  • 最近在研究设备指纹,看到现下比较靠谱的是canvas指纹,能够忽略无痕模式的影响,保证浏览器指纹的稳定性,于是想尝试一下。但是尝试了一下发现chrome,IE10,Edge,Firefox,Opera在正常模式和无痕模式下,设备指纹都是一致的,唯独safari有点不同,无痕模式下不管怎么刷新,指纹D都是保持不变,而在正常模式下,有一定...
    2020-06-08
    1
  • 1、在关闭ARC的情况下,为什么一个Object-c对象主动release后,其成员变量还能继续访问?代码如下: {代码...} 问题:在调用[p release];后,还能继续访问p的变量a; 问题: [p release]后还能继续访问为什么不报错? 看建议是release后最好不要继续访问。 如果能访问,什么情况下会出问题?
    2016-05-15
    1
    ✓ 已解决
  • 成员变量主要是适用于iOS5之前的开发,需要程序员手动进行内存管理。iOS5之后(包括iOS5)引入了ARC(Automatic Reference Counting)同过在property中使用strong,weak等标记自动对内存进行管理。也就是说进行iOS5及以后系统版本的开发,可以放心的使用property,而无需对其进行手动的内存管理。property会自动生成sette...
    2015-09-07
  • 椭圆代码 {代码...} 实现 {代码...} 想让圆变成椭圆然后变回圆的一个动画,但是这里就很奇怪,就算不传入参数,每次执行圆心不同,左边位移也不同。
    2017-10-29
    1
  • 在HarmonyOS NEXT开发中Canvas设置渐变色没有效果?使用CanvasRenderingContext2D的createLinearGradient(0, 0, 5, 0)函数创建的渐变对象,这里面的参数没太明白是什么意思?我添加了两种渐变色,但是始终只显示一种颜色。
    2025-03-11
    1
    ✓ 已解决
  • 因为ARC是编译器特性,而不是iOS运行时特性,更不是其他语言中的垃圾收集器。所以这就意味这它只能处理在编译时就确定的内存管理,所用的机制就是引用计数。换句话来讲,他的内存释放不是强制的,比如内存相互引用,动态引用等会导致引用计数不会立刻置0,所以这个时候显式释放是有必要的。
    2016-10-20
  • {代码...} 具体的问题 好好读读这个[链接]读完你就全明白了 内存管理就这点事儿
    2015-09-11
  • {代码...}
    2020-03-12
    2
    ✓ 已解决